SEA PRO BOATS HAS MADE DOMETIC’S SEASTAR STEERING EQUIPMENT STANDARD EQUIPMENT

Seastar Steering Equipment

Dec 3, 2019

Dometic has announced that South Carolina-based builder Sea Pro Boats is making SeaStar Optimus EPS and SeaStar Power Assist steering standard equipment on its larger, high-horsepower boat models.

Sea Pro’s popular 259 DLX and soon-to-be-launched 319 DLX center console fishing machines are the flagships of the Sea Pro line, which includes bay boats and deep-vee center consoles from 17 to 31 feet.  The 259 DLX and 319 DLX measure 25’ 9” and 31’ 9” respectively, are built for today’s large, powerful outboard motors. These boat models are packed with the latest features and advanced technology — making them an ideal match for Optimus EPS (Electronic Power Steering).  Sea Pro will also be offering SeaStar Optimus 360 Joystick control as a factory option on these top-of-the-line models.

Optimus EPS provides today’s high-performance fishing boats with sports car like steering for superior comfort, control and maneuverability, along with the ability to fine-tune system parameters to match specific boat and operator preferences.  Optimus Joystick control simplifies docking, launching/retrieving and other close quarter maneuvers, taking much of the stress out of boating.

Sea Pro is also making SeaStar Power Assist steering standard equipment on the rest of its boat models rated for 150 horsepower outboards or larger. SeaStar Power Assist provides increased comfort and lighter steering loads for operators of bay boats and offshore center consoles with larger outboards.
